Join us for morning and evening prayer as we pray with you through the Anglican Daily Office. In addition to guided prayer, Scripture readings are included that follow the 3 year cycle of the church calendar. Presented by Crossroads Abby.

I went through 2021 using this daily office podcast regularly. I’ve tried a few but this one is by far the best. It is professionally done, follows the lectionary and calendar, and is consistent! In all of 2021 he only missed a couple - and never an entire day. If you are serious about doing this find a 2019 BCP and worship with Fr David. You won’t be disappointed!
